Shubman Gill’s return to the Gujarat Titans’ dugout after a short injury layoff isn’t just another match-day moment for the IPL. It’s a statement that the franchise’s best batter is back exactly where he belongs, leading from the front and ready to remind everyone why he remains the most complete opener in the competition. The 26-year-old captain missed Gujarat’s last game against Rajasthan Royals after picking up a muscle spasm, an absence that briefly handed the armband to Rashid Khan for a single outing. Yet that one-game experiment also showed how the Titans function when their star batter is sidelined. Now that Gill is fit again, the focus shifts immediately to whether he can rediscover the form that made him the fulcrum of a Gujarat side that finished third in the 2025 season and propelled him into the India captaincy.
His return to the crease on April 9, 2026 against Delhi Capitals at the Arun Jaitley Stadium isn’t about rust or hesitation. It’s about reminding the league that Gill is the kind of batter who can tilt an entire tournament single-handedly. In the 2023 campaign alone he amassed 890 runs and struck three centuries, numbers that underline his ability to dominate bowlers and dictate terms. His absence last Monday might have given the Titans a glimpse of life without him at the top, but his comeback is less about recovery and more about re-establishing his reputation as the most complete opener in the league today.
What makes Gill’s 2026 comeback even more compelling is how it intersects with his larger career arc. Just two years ago he was the young prodigy from the 2018 U19 World Cup still finding his feet. Today he stands as the leader of the Gujarat Titans, the Test and ODI captain of India, and the owner of Test double-centuries, ODI double-centuries, and a T20I hundred. His 269 against England in Birmingham remains the highest score ever by an Indian captain in Test cricket, a record that only underscores the weight he carries at the crease. Yet for all his international laurels, the IPL remains the proving ground where his reputation is truly forged.

His average of 39.44 over 119 matches is solid, but the eye-catching number is his strike rate of 138.77, a figure that places him among the most dynamic openers in the competition. In 2023 he blazed through the season with a strike rate of 157.80, including three hundreds, a reminder that when Gill is in rhythm he doesn’t just score runs. He dictates terms. The Titans have the personnel to capitalize on that aggression, with Jos Buttler offering a similar explosive presence at the top and Sai Sudharsan providing a calm, classical foil. Together they form a top order that can unsettle any bowling attack in the league.
